Listen for the haunting calls of loons as you explore the vast waterways of the Boundary Waters Canoe Area Wilderness on foot. Visit the sacred Three Maidens of Pipestone National Monument, which stand guard over some of Minnesota's last tallgrass prairie. Or step back into history at the confluence of the Minnesota and Mississippi rivers with a hike around Fort Snelling. Detailed maps, elevation profiles, and even global positioning system coordinates eliminate the guesswork, allowing you to concentrate on your adventure. With a wealth of information on ecology, geology, state history, and useful hiking tips for beginners and experts alike,
Hiking Minnesota is the only reference you'll need when the North Woods beckon.
